Abstract
Objective To study the effect of continuous nursing on the quality of life of patients with breast cancer after surgery, such as psychological status and clinical recovery. Methods 100 patients after breast cancer operation were randomly divided into two groups, with 50 patients in each. The observation group was given continuous postoperative nursing, and a systematic evaluation of the psychological status in six month after surgery. Besides, the rate of awareness of related disease knowledge was compared between these two groups before the patients were discharged. Results After six months, the SAS, SDS, SES score of the observation group were respectively (36.61±4.37), (32.81±3.19), (24.47±4.6), which were better than those of the control group (42.34±4.31), (39.39±3.93), (18.49±3.3), with statistically significant difference (P <0.05). The rate of awareness of related disease knowledge in the observation group was 96%, higher than the 66% in the control group, with statistically significant difference (P <0.05).
